Pulmonary Late Policy

(Originally posted on: March 11, 2016

Clinic Visits

Return visit –

  • If the patient arrives after the end of clinic (after 11:45am  for morning clinic, after 4:45 pm for afternoon clinic, they will not be seen).
  • If the patient arrives up to 20 minutes after appointment time, check in as on time.  Physician can let patient know that they only have X minutes to spend to avoid delaying the next patient.
  • If the patient arrives >20 minutes late front desk notifies patient that the physician will attempt to see them but that there will be a wait to avoid delaying other patients who arrived on time.
    • If patient chooses not to wait – notify physician and nurse, patient is rescheduled.
    • If there is an opening on the doc’s schedule later that day, CSR can move the patient to use the later time slot (if acceptable to patient). CSR notifies MA and doc.
    • If there is NO opening, contact doc to see if patient can still be seen (work into schedule).  If physician cannot see patient (needs to leave for satellite, etc) – physician must speak with patient.

New visits

  • If the patient arrives after the end of clinic (after 11:45am  for morning clinic, after 4:45 pm for afternoon clinic, they will not be seen).
  • If the patient arrives up to 20 minutes after visit time, check in for MD visit. (see pft rules)
  • If the patient arrives >20 minutes after visit time (this means arrived at least 50 minutes AFTER pft appointment time) into MD visit, patient is notified that the appointment may need to be rescheduled, but will check if the physician can still see the patient (but that this would be an abbreviated visit).  If patient cannot be seen, physician must speak with patient.

CSR can reschedule that day in this order:

  • Original provider new slot
  • Resident, fellow, then other general staff in clinic that day
  • If none, check if Shannon Neumann has an opening – if so, ask checker to review if patient can be seen by her (copd and asthma).

 

Pulmonary Function Testing

  • Patient arrives up to 20 minutes after appointment time – check in, PFT lab will be performed

 

  • Patient arrives >20 minutes after appointment time:
    • PFT + MD visit: Do not send patient back for PFT. CSR notifies MAs so that the MA is not waiting for PFTs to room patient.  MA notifies MD that patient arrived too late to have pfts done prior to visit without delaying other appointments. (If MD wants PFTs – will be done after patient is seen if wait is acceptable to patient.  Patients coming from 30 minutes away will be given priority).
    • PFT only: Contact the PFT lab to see when the patient can be tested.
      • If the wait is acceptable of the wait time, CSR checks them in for appointment.
      • If the wait is unacceptable – patient to be rescheduled.
    • PFT +K16 (Transplant) – Contact K16 to determine if they still want testing performed.  If K16 still requires testing before or after the transplant visit, contact the lab to determine wait time.  Patients coming from >30 minutes away would be given priority.
